Title
Derbyshire County Council Children's Home: The Old Post House
Date
1994-2016
Description
Children's home records including the following:
Financial records including bank statements 2004-2014 and invoices and payment vouchers 2013-2015; Care records for a named child 2015-2016; Household records including communications books 2012-2015, log books 2012-2015, complaints register 1994-2010, staff timesheets 2005-2006 and shift planning records 2014-2015; Human resources records 2004-2015
Extent
6 boxes

Administrative History
The Old Post House
Owner: Derbyshire County Council
Area: North East Derbyshire
Opened: February 1993. Still open as at July 2016.
History: The home was originally known as Top Road family centre. It is a large detached house on a busy main road in and out of Chesterfield, opposite the current post office. Its name was changed from Top Road to The Old Post Office on 1 April 2013.
Units: None. Open house.
Clientele: Accommodates 4 children aged 11-17 for medium to long term care, male and female.
Custodial History
These records were deposited in Derbyshire Record Office in August 2016.
